Under pressure after projectiles were fired at civilian targets in Smara, the Polisario announced the adoption of a «code of conduct» intended to regulate the actions of its armed elements. It has also created a new military body tasked with monitoring compliance with international humanitarian law, against a backdrop of strong international reactions, particularly from the United States.

The Dutch municipality of Kapelle held its annual commemoration on Tuesday in tribute to Moroccan and French soldiers who died during the fighting in Zeeland in May 1940, in the early days of World War II. The ceremony, organized every year since 1950, brought together representatives of the Moroccan and French diplomatic corps, members of the Dutch armed forces, military attachés, veterans, and memorial organizations, local media reported. French President Emmanuel Macron has defended the planned increase in tuition fees for non-European Union students, particularly those from Africa, at French public universities. Speaking in an interview marking the close of the Africa Forward Summit on May 12 in Nairobi, he argued that French taxpayers should not have to «pay for the education of all the students in the world, wherever they come from».
Morocco will suspend soft wheat imports from June 1 to July 31, as forecasts point to a sharp recovery in domestic grain production following heavy rainfall that brought an end to seven years of drought. The expected harvest, including soft wheat, is projected to nearly double this season to around nine million tonnes. The Polisario is opposing the proposed strategic review of MINURSO’s mandate, examined by the UN Security Council on April 23 and 30 in accordance with Resolution 2797, adopted on October 31, 2025. Bachir Mustapha Sayed, the Polisario’s «parliament speaker», warned on Monday night that «any change to MINURSO’s prerogatives would only fuel escalation and instability in the region».
